Range and Efficiency
Even though the Kia EV9 Long Range RWD (2023-…) has a larger battery, the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 (2022-2023) higher energy efficiency results in a longer real-world driving range.
| Property | Kia EV9 Long Range RWD |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 |
|---|---|---|
| Range (EPA) | 491 km | - Range (EPA) |
| Range (WLTP) | 563 km | 560 km |
| Range (GCC) | 473 km | 478 km |
| Battery Capacity (Nominal) | 99.8 kWh | 82 kWh |
| Battery Capacity (Usable) | 96 kWh | 77 kWh |
| Efficiency per 100 km | 20.3 kWh/100 km | 16.1 kWh/100 km |
| Efficiency per kWh | 4.93 km/kWh | 6.21 km/kWh |
| Range and Efficiency Score | 6.9 | 8.3 |
Charging
The Kia EV9 Long Range RWD (2023-…) features an advanced 800-volt architecture, whereas the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 (2022-2023) relies on a standard 400-volt system.
The Kia EV9 Long Range RWD (2023-…) offers faster charging speeds at DC stations, reaching up to 210 kW, while the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 (2022-2023) maxes out at 143 kW.
The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 (2022-2023) features a more powerful on-board charger, supporting a maximum AC charging power of 11 kW, whereas the Kia EV9 Long Range RWD (2023-…) is limited to 10.5 kW.
| Property | Kia EV9 Long Range RWD |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 |
|---|---|---|
| Max Charging Power (AC) | 10.5 kW | 11 kW |
| Max Charging Power (DC) | 210 kW | 143 kW |
| Architecture | 800 V | 400 V |
| Charge Port | CCS Type 2 | CCS Type 2 |
| Charging Score | 7.9 | 6.4 |
Performance
Both vehicles are rear-wheel drive.
Both cars offer the same motor power, but the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 (2022-2023) achieves a faster 0-100 km/h time.
| Property | Kia EV9 Long Range RWD |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 |
|---|---|---|
| Drive Type | RWD | RWD |
| Motor Type | PMSM | PMSM |
| Motor Power (kW) | 150 kW | 150 kW |
| Motor Power (hp) | 201 hp | 201 hp |
| Motor Torque | 350 Nm | 310 Nm |
| 0-100 km/h | 9.4 s | 8.7 s |
| Top Speed | 185 km/h | 160 km/h |
| Performance Score | 3.6 | 3.3 |

Cargo and Towing
The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 (2022-2023) features a larger trunk, but the Kia EV9 Long Range RWD (2023-…) offers greater maximum cargo capacity when the rear seats are folded.
A frunk (front trunk) is available in the Kia EV9 Long Range RWD (2023-…), but the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 (2022-2023) doesn’t have one.
The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 (2022-2023) is better suited for heavy loads, offering a greater towing capacity than the Kia EV9 Long Range RWD (2023-…).
| Property | Kia EV9 Long Range RWD | Škoda Enyaq Coupe iV 80 |
|---|---|---|
| Number of Seats | 6, 7 | 5 |
| Curb Weight | 2501 kg | 2119 kg |
| Cargo Volume (Trunk) | 333 l | 575 l |
| Cargo Volume (Max) | 2393 l | 1700 l |
| Cargo Volume (Frunk) | 90 l | - Cargo Volume (Frunk) |
| Towing Capacity | 900 kg | 1000 kg |
| Cargo and Towing Score | 8.7 | 7 |
